        Hi, can I check with you all since Cheng Chung (CC) is affiliated to NYJC, does that infer that CC students have the advantage when it comes to O level L1R5 total points as compared to NCHS students when being considered for NYJC entry? If true, a CC student seemingly needs lesser effort to hit the required score as compared to other students who are non-affiliated to enter NYJC, right? I’m now considering between NC and CC for my DD. Thanks a lot.

          Being affiliated to a JC isn't a huge advantage. There are bonus points (2 points) if you choose the affiliated JC as your first, or first and second choice. However, you can earn the points from elsewhere and there is a cap to the bonus points you can earn (4 points from the section). See http://www.ifaq.gov.sg/moe/apps/fcd_faqmain.aspx#FAQ_55558.

                  Fro me the main difference is dat Nan Chiau have ALP which is offered to the whole level in yr 1 and 2. Nan Chiau is stronger in Science also so is to the advantage of my kid since she aiming sci stream in JC. Heard from the HOD dat the kids r doing Arduino programming as a project under ALP.


                  List of schs offering ALP Programme fm MOE:
                  https://www.moe.gov.sg/docs/default-source/document/education/secondary/applied-learning/list-of-schools-offering-alp.pdf

                  Also find Nan Chiau more accessible than Chung Cheng Main during rainy days.
